Synopsis of Scarlett
Scarlett es una novela escrita por Alexandra Ripley como secuela de la famosa obra de Margaret Mitchell, 'Lo que el viento se llevó'. La historia retoma la vida de Scarlett O'Hara, explorando su búsqueda de la felicidad tras los eventos de la novela original. Ambientada en lugares como Tara, ciudades ocupadas y la Irlanda de los O'Hara, Scarlett se transforma en una mujer independiente y segura de sí misma. Esta edición en español, publicada por Ediciones B, ofrece a los lectores la oportunidad de revivir la inolvidable continuación de una de las historias de amor más queridas de la literatura.

Alexandra Ripley
Alexandra Ripley was an American writer best known as the author of Scarlett (1991), written as a sequel to Gone with the Wind. Her first novel was Who's the Lady in the President's Bed? (1972). Charleston (1981), her first historical novel, was a bestseller, as were her next books On Leaving Charleston (1984), The Time Returns (1985), and New Orleans Legacy (1987).
